Step-by-step explanation:

Here is the data.

10 5 8 10 12 6

8 10 15 6 12 18

The given data:   10   5   8   10   12   6   8   10   15   6   12   18

For finding the Mean, we will have to add all numbers together and divide it by total number. i.e sum of terms divided by number of terms  

Mean= 10+5+8+10+12+6+8+10+15+6+12+18  ÷ 12

Mean = 120 ÷ 12 = 10        

For finding the Median, first we need to rearrange the data in ascending order

5   6   6   8   8   10   10   10   12   12   15   18

We can see that the middle values are 10 and 10. So, the median will be the average of those two middle values.

Median = 10+10 ÷ 2

Median = 20 ÷ 2 = 10

From the calculation, we can see that both the median and mean are equal so, the data is symmetrical
